GENCO and KeyTone to offer RFID Training

GENCO and KeyTone Technologies have formed an alliance to provide hands on RFID training in real supply chain environment. The training program is referred to as RFID Applied2U. The course curriculum will impart training through a variety of live applications in a real supply chain environment. The training module will provide in depth knowledge of RFID, implementation approach and the necessary success factors to deliver RFID initiative. In the starting only two courses would be offered, RFID for Managers and RFID Operations and project Management. Later on courses such as RFID Application Development and Integration and RFID Networking and Troubleshooting would be introduced. The first course will commence on 7th February.
